Evaluating Different Liner Materials
When selecting 2.2 quart air fryer liners, understanding the various material options is crucial for optimizing your cooking experience. Each type of liner offers distinct advantages and drawbacks that can affect both cooking outcomes and cleanup efficiency.
Parchment Paper Liners
- Pros: Parchment paper liners are non-stick and can handle high temperatures, making them ideal for air frying. They help prevent food from sticking to the basket, simplifying cleanup.
- Cons: These liners are generally single-use, which might not be the most eco-friendly option. They can also catch fire if not properly monitored during cooking.
Silicone Mats
- Pros: Reusable silicone mats are durable and can withstand high temperatures, making them a sustainable choice. They provide a non-stick surface, promoting easy food release and are dishwasher safe for hassle-free cleaning.
- Cons: Silicone mats may not fit snugly in all 2.2 quart air fryers, leading to potential sliding during cooking. Additionally, they may not absorb grease as effectively as paper liners, which could impact the crispiness of certain foods.
Aluminum Foil
- Pros: Aluminum foil liners are versatile and can be molded to fit various shapes within the air fryer. They can withstand high heat and are excellent for wrapping foods that need to be cooked evenly.
- Cons: Using aluminum foil can sometimes lead to uneven cooking if not properly placed. It can also react with acidic foods, potentially altering the flavor. Moreover, like parchment paper, foil is typically single-use, raising environmental concerns.

Potential Risks and Limitations of Using Air Fryer Liners
When selecting 2.2 quart air fryer liners, it's essential to consider the potential risks and limitations associated with their use. While liners can enhance your cooking experience, improper use or compatibility issues may lead to several concerns.
-
Safety Concerns: Not all liners are made from heat-resistant materials. Using liners that can’t withstand high temperatures may result in melting or releasing harmful substances into your food. Always check the manufacturer's specifications to ensure that the liner is rated for air frying temperatures.
-
Impact on Food Flavor and Texture: If a liner is not suited for the specific type of food being prepared, it can alter the flavor and texture of the dish. For example, certain materials may impart an unwanted taste or prevent proper browning, which is a key benefit of air frying.
-
Compatibility Issues: Ensure that the liner fits well within your 2.2 quart air fryer. Liners that are too large or small can interfere with air circulation, potentially leading to uneven cooking or burning of the liner itself.
-
Cleanup Complications: Some liners may not perform well during the cooking process, leading to residue build-up that can complicate cleanup. Consider the ease of cleaning when selecting a liner, as some materials may require more effort to maintain than others.

Frequently Asked Questions About 2.2 Quart Air Fryer Liners
When selecting the right 2.2 quart air fryer liners, it's common to have questions about compatibility, maintenance, and safety. Here are answers to some frequently asked queries that can help enhance your understanding and confidence in your choices.
Can I use regular baking paper as an air fryer liner?
While regular baking paper may be used in an air fryer, it’s essential to ensure that it is safe for high temperatures. Many air fryer liners are specifically designed to withstand the heat generated in air fryers, often featuring coatings that baking paper lacks. If you choose to use baking paper, make sure it is unbleached and free from any additives that could potentially release toxins when heated.
How often should I replace my air fryer liners?
The frequency of replacing your air fryer liners largely depends on the type of liner you use. Disposable parchment liners should be replaced after each use to maintain hygiene and prevent any buildup of grease or food particles. Reusable silicone liners can last longer but should be cleaned regularly and replaced when they show signs of wear, such as tears or discoloration.
Are there any liners I should avoid for my air fryer?
When selecting liners for your 2.2 quart air fryer, it’s crucial to avoid those made from materials that are not heat-resistant or safe for cooking. For example, plastic liners can melt and release harmful chemicals. Additionally, avoid any liners that do not fit well in your air fryer, as they can obstruct airflow and affect cooking performance. Always check the manufacturer's recommendations to ensure compatibility and safety.
